A LEFT-HAND DAGGER, EARLY 17TH CENTURY PROBABLY GERMAN

with robust tapering blade of hollow-diamond section, iron hilt cut with a fine chequered design (perhaps later) over almost its entire surface, comprising drooped quillons with bud-shaped terminals, outer ring-guard, near spherical pommel, and the grip with a later wire binding between 'Turk's Heads', 27.3 cm blade
